Nottingham Forest Sign Liam Delap From Chelsea in Club-Record £45m Deal

Nottingham Forest have completed the £45m signing of Liam Delap from Chelsea, making the 23-year-old striker the club’s record signing after Oliver Glasner pushed for his arrival.

Nottingham Forest have completed the signing of 23-year-old striker Liam Delap from Chelsea in a club-record £45 million deal.

Delap becomes the latest major addition to Oliver Glasner’s Forest project, with the manager understood to have been particularly keen on bringing the England striker to the City Ground. Reports confirm that Forest reached an agreement with Chelsea for the permanent transfer, with Delap now set to continue his career in the Premier League.

The forward only joined Chelsea from Ipswich Town last summer for around £30 million, but his time at Stamford Bridge has lasted just one season. Chelsea were willing to sell as part of their ongoing squad reshuffle, while Delap was also informed that he was no longer central to the club’s plans.

Forest faced competition for Delap, with Everton and Leeds United among the clubs interested, but the striker ultimately chose to remain in the Premier League and join Glasner’s ambitious project.

The move represents a major statement from Forest, who are continuing to strengthen their squad with ambitious signings. Delap now arrives at the City Ground with significant expectations on his shoulders, as the club’s record signing.

For Chelsea, the transfer brings a quick financial return on a player signed only last year. For Forest, it is a significant investment in a young English striker they believe can become a key figure for years to come.
